Else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
This surname is derived from the name of an ancestor. 'the son of Ellis', a variant of Ellis, which see.
David Elyse, Flintshire, 1635: Wills at 'ster (1621-50).
1785. — William Else and Margaret Saul: ibid.
1 Ell’s (Son): v. Ell.
2 the Anglo-Saxon pers. name Elsa Eádwine sóhte ic and Elsan.
(Eadwine sought I and Elsa).—The Scóp’s Tale, 1. 235.
(German, Dutch) Dweller at, or near, the alder tree; one who came from Elsen (alder), in Germany.
William Else was a copyholder of Bonsall in the reign of James I. (G.). John Elus lived in the wapentake of Wirksworth in the time of Edward I. (H. R.).

How Common Is The Last Name Else? popularity and diffusion
Else is the 89,907th most numerous family name world-wide, borne by approximately 1 in 1,366,244 people. This last name occurs predominantly in Europe, where 42 percent of Else are found; 37 percent are found in Northern Europe and 36 percent are found in British Isles. Else is also the 6,980th most frequent first name in the world, held by 150,338 people.
The last name is most widely held in England, where it is carried by 1,878 people, or 1 in 29,669. In England it is most common in: Derbyshire, where 20 percent live, Nottinghamshire, where 8 percent live and South Yorkshire, where 7 percent live. Apart from England Else is found in 52 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 27 percent live and South Africa, where 10 percent live.
Else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Else has changed over time. In England the share of the population with the surname rose 190 percent between 1881 and 2014; in The United States it rose 595 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in Scotland it rose 2,100 percent between 1881 and 2014.
